This happened to me during a week course in an CISCO center. There I had suppose full net access, of course I didn't believe that was full net access...

But what I didn't espect is that every time I made "apt-get update" plus "apt-get install" or "apt-get dist-upgrade" I got some retrieved list files corrupeted...

I made some tests, at home or office everything finr, in CISCO center I got apt db for sources corrupted. So, they have some kind of bad filter or even faulty configured, probably an WAAS.

I've been solved this problem by removing the conflicting files and update the list

sudo rm -rf /var/lib/apt/lists/*
sudo apt-get update

do it over and over until all conflicting files removed clearly
